Henri Fayol is widely regarded as the father
of modern management. His management
theories, mostly developed and published in
the 1900s, were a major influence on the
development of industrial management
practice throughout the twentieth century.

The Six industrial Activities
• 1.Technical, including production, manufacturing, and adaption.
• 2. Commercial, including markets, contracts,buying, selling and exchange.
• 3. Financial, involving the search for and optimum use of capital.
• 4. Security, involving the protection of people and property.
• 5. Accounting, stocktaking, and balance sheet, costs, and statistics.
• 6. Managerial, including planning, organizing, command, coordination and control
